Toshiba to ship all its future laptops with built-in HD DVD drive

June 8, 2007 10:26 pm

Toshiba, one of the leading supporters of HD DVD format, has now thought of going fully HD DVD with its notebooks. The company has plans to ship all its upcoming laptops with built-in HD DVD drives. A study done by IDC lately has concluded that Toshiba has sold 9.2 million laptops till the date.

Blu-ray disc enabled Sony VAIO Notebook

May 23, 2007 10:38 pm

On May 16th Sony unveiled its latest high tech notebook computer - VAIO AR. This is the first computer that is Blu-ray disc enabled. This comes on the heels of Maxell’s latest announcement of a 200GB Blu-ray disc.
This little wonder is not all brains only, it can be fun too. It’s packed with a host of entertainment features that allow you to watch and record your favorite television shows. Its graphics card will be of real interest to game junkies. It’s got an NVIDIA GeForce Go 7600 graphics card featuring 256MB dedicated video memory. This means that you will also be able to enjoy your DVDs and movies on the notebook itself. Of course if you already have one of those big screen TVs with high definition, you can always attach the notebook to the TV to watch your DVDs.
